

在魔兽争霸的MOD开发与地图编辑领域,技能范围的视觉呈现是衡量技能设计专业度的重要指标。通过修改基础技能参数与投射物属性,开发者可以创造出锥形火焰喷射、环形闪电链等复杂范围效果。这种自定义不仅影响视觉表现,更直接关联技能的实际判定逻辑与战斗策略深度。
技能范围的基础分类体系
根据偶久网的制图教程,技能范围可分为线形、面形、单体三类基础类型。线形技能通过调整"起始宽度"和"终止宽度"参数,可将传统的直线型技能改造为扇形区域,例如将风暴之锤的投射轨迹修改为60度扩散的锥形区域。面形技能则依托"作用范围半径"参数,例如暴风雪的基础作用范围是200码,通过扩大该数值可形成直径400码的超大范围打击区域。
魔兽争霸3引擎支持动态范围显示技术,当玩家按住ALT键预览技能时,系统会根据技能数据参数实时生成半透明特效。这要求开发者在"效果-投射物图像"字段中设置合理的材质贴图,例如将火球术的圆形贴图替换为三角形贴图,即可实现锥形范围的视觉呈现。
编辑器核心参数详解
在物体编辑器的技能属性面板中,"射弹弧度"参数控制着投射物的抛物线轨迹。当该值设置为0.5时,火球会以45度仰角飞行,其落地后形成的爆炸范围会呈现为标准圆形;若调整为0.8则会产生陡峭的抛物线,配合"终止宽度"调整可形成椭圆形伤害区域。
射弹速度"与范围显示的关联常被忽视。实测数据显示,当射弹速度超过800时,系统会默认缩短范围指示器的持续时间。这需要通过触发器补偿:在技能释放时添加"创建特效-绑定单位"事件,用持续6秒的发光体特效替代系统默认的2秒范围显示。
引导技能的进阶应用
群体风暴锤的案例证明了引导技能选择的灵活性。虽然该技能本质是面形范围攻击,但开发者可以选用单体引导技能作为载体。这种设计的关键在于"目标允许"字段的设置:将"目标类型"设为空,在触发器中用"单位组-选取圆形范围内单位"实现实际作用,这样既能保留单体技能的施法动作,又能显示自定义的范围指示器。
针对持续性技能的范围显示,《冰封王座》的引擎存在特殊机制。当设置"持续时间"超过10秒时,需要将"状态-持续"字段设为真,并在"视觉效果-循环特效"中添加动态范围指示器。知名地图作者Darkness曾在《守卫剑阁》MOD中创新性地使用旋转刀阵特效,通过每0.5秒刷新一次的环形特效实现了动态范围提示。
实战调试与兼容处理
在《DOTA》地图开发过程中,技能范围显示曾引发著名的"影魔毁灭阴影"调试事件。原始设计的200°扇形范围因角度计算偏差,实际生效角度仅160°。开发者通过分段调试发现:引擎的扇形角度计算基于单位面向角度±设定值的三角函数,需要将显示角度设置为实际角度的1.25倍才能准确匹配。
多人对战中的范围显示同步问题需特别注意。当自定义范围超过600码时,不同步的客户端会出现"范围显示漂移"。解决方案是在触发器中使用"本地玩家"条件判断,配合"镜头-获取玩家视角"命令,动态调整范围指示器的位置偏移量。这种方法在《澄海3C》的5.56版本中成功解决了光击阵的范围显示异步问题。
未来开发的技术展望
随着魔兽争霸重制版的推出,基于粒子系统的3D范围显示成为可能。新一代引擎支持动态高度检测,允许开发者创建球形、圆柱形等三维范围指示器。测试数据显示,使用3D范围显示可使玩家对空对地复合技能的识别速度提升40%。
AI辅助设计工具正在改变传统开发模式。通过机器学习算法分析5000张经典地图的技能参数,智能系统可自动生成范围显示方案。在2023年的MOD开发大赛中,获奖作品《星界裂隙》90%的范围显示设计均由AI辅助完成,其多层级嵌套范围提示系统获得专业评审最高评分。
本文揭示的技能范围自定义技术,既是MOD开发的必备技能,也是理解即时战略游戏底层逻辑的重要窗口。随着引擎技术的迭代和AI工具的普及,技能范围设计正从数值调整转向智能生成的新阶段,这为游戏开发者开辟了更广阔的创新空间。
郑重声明:
以上内容均源自于网络,内容仅用于个人学习、研究或者公益分享,非商业用途,如若侵犯到您的权益,请联系删除,客服QQ:841144146
相关阅读
Cobe画廊藏家攻略:三周捡漏秘籍
2025-12-05 11:39:40热血江湖小号社交互动指南:如何在游戏内建立良好的人际关系
2025-11-06 10:59:19传奇霸业神威狱的机制详解:如何利用此环境进行攻击
2025-11-05 13:08:14《热血江湖》中的霸玉石:如何有效收集与使用避免资源浪费
2025-10-18 13:44:16《热血江湖雷电版本》宠物系统详解:如何培养和利用你的宠物
2025-10-18 13:32:49